深入理解Excel编程与数据处理技巧
背景简介
在处理复杂的电子表格和数据集时,掌握Excel编程技术是提高工作效率的关键。本书第79章深入探讨了在Excel中使用VBA进行编程和数据处理的高级技巧,包括编辑、导出、处理XML数据、开发表单和控件,以及集成外部数据源等。本章内容不仅对初学者有着极大的启发,对于经验丰富的用户也同样提供了许多实用的解决方案。
编辑与导出组件
在处理Excel工作簿时,经常会遇到需要导出数据到其他格式的场景。本章详细介绍了如何使用VBA编辑器来导出工作表数据,以及如何处理和纠正XML数据。例如,使用 Export
方法导出组件,或者通过 ExportInvoiceXML
过程导出发票数据。对于数据导出,本章也提到了处理错误和异常的最佳实践。
代码设置与编辑器特性
程序员在编码时往往需要根据项目需求调整代码的设置。本章介绍了如何在VBA编辑器中配置代码设置,包括编辑器格式、语法高亮、自动语法检查等特性,以提高开发效率。
处理XML数据
XML数据在现代办公自动化和数据交换中扮演着重要角色。本章详细解释了如何处理和纠正XML数据,包括在删除工作表时处理错误的方法。此外,还探讨了XML数据的导出方法,这对于需要将Excel数据整合到其他系统中的用户非常有用。
开发表单与控件
在Excel中创建交互式表单和控件是提高用户体验的有效方式。本章介绍了一系列开发表单和控件的技巧,从创建简单的按钮到复杂的ActiveX控件。例如,使用 CommandBarButton
来创建自定义按钮,以及如何在表单中处理事件。
代码优化与错误处理
优化代码和有效处理错误是提高程序质量的关键。本章深入探讨了代码优化的技巧,比如避免硬编码值、使用循环和条件语句的正确方法,以及如何在代码中设置断点。此外,本章还提供了关于错误处理的建议,例如如何追踪表单事件和调试代码。
集成外部数据源
为了使Excel成为更加强大的数据处理工具,本章还介绍了如何将外部数据源集成到Excel中。无论是从数据库导入数据还是将数据导出到数据库,本章都提供了详细的步骤和示例代码。
总结与启发
通过阅读本章,我们可以看到Excel不仅仅是一个电子表格工具,它更是一个强大的编程和数据处理平台。掌握Excel VBA编程技术,可以让我们更加高效地处理和分析数据。本章的内容提醒我们,要重视代码的可维护性和错误处理,这些实践不仅能够提高开发效率,还能确保程序在生产环境中的稳定性。同时,通过将Excel与其他数据源的集成,我们能够构建更为复杂和强大的应用程序。
在未来,随着技术的发展,我们可以期待Excel VBA会引入更多强大的功能,以支持更复杂的自动化任务。而对于程序员来说,学习如何有效地使用Excel编程工具,将永远是一项宝贵的技能。